dc.description.abstractThis research aims to characterize the pattern of expression of BMP-15 during in vitro maturation of canine oocyte. BMP-15 is a follicular factor related to the oocyte maturation, taking part in cumulus cells expansion and resumption meiotic, however still has not been described in the bitch, whose cumulus expansion and meiotic resumption occurs with delay, hindering the replication in labs condition, limiting the success rate in the in vitro maturation of oocytes. BMP-15 is a possible responsible. By mean of western blotting and indirect immunofluorescence, BMP-15 was evaluated in canine cumulus oocyte complex (COCs) cultured during 48, 72 and 96 hours. BMP-15 is present both oocyte and cumulus cells increased its level significantly (P<0.05) while in vitro culture progress. BMP-15 is related whit meiotic progression and cumulus cells expansion. So, BMP-15 has a role in the oocyte maturation of the bitch.
